[{"data":1,"prerenderedAt":-1},["ShallowReactive",2],{"$fPZVTlbh7rHGHnF24uZpEsTuYWp0t8IxD3qyXfu_k61c":3},{"slug":4,"name":5,"version":6,"author":7,"author_profile":8,"description":9,"short_description":10,"active_installs":11,"downloaded":12,"rating":13,"num_ratings":14,"last_updated":15,"tested_up_to":16,"requires_at_least":17,"requires_php":18,"tags":19,"homepage":25,"download_link":26,"security_score":27,"vuln_count":28,"unpatched_count":28,"last_vuln_date":29,"fetched_at":30,"vulnerabilities":31,"developer":32,"crawl_stats":29,"alternatives":40,"analysis":137,"fingerprints":182},"category-subcategory-list-widget","Category and Subcategory List Widget","7.3","Murali","https:\u002F\u002Fprofiles.wordpress.org\u002Fmurali-indiacitys\u002F","\u003Cp>WordPress press widget to list category and subcategories of posts\u002Fcustom taxonomies of custom post types.\u003C\u002Fp>\n\u003Cp>Features\u003C\u002Fp>\n\u003Col>\n\u003Cli>\n\u003Cp>It allows users to add custom icons for category or for subcategory or for custom taxonomies\u003C\u002Fp>\n\u003C\u002Fli>\n\u003Cli>\n\u003Cp>It lists categories and subcategories in user-friendly horizontal pattern. Please refer screenshots.\u003C\u002Fp>\n\u003C\u002Fli>\n\u003Cli>\n\u003Cp>Category icons can be edited\u002Fremoved\u002Fupdate with new icons under edit category or under edit custom taxonomy admin screen\u003C\u002Fp>\n\u003C\u002Fli>\n\u003Cli>\n\u003Cp>Admin settings of this widget has facility control display on\u002Foff for category icons\u003C\u002Fp>\n\u003C\u002Fli>\n\u003Cli>\n\u003Cp>Admin settings of this wiget has facility to show\u002Fhide count of posts in categories\u003C\u002Fp>\n\u003C\u002Fli>\n\u003Cli>\n\u003Cp>Admin settings of this widget has facility to show\u002Fhide empty categories in widget\u003C\u002Fp>\n\u003C\u002Fli>\n\u003Cli>\n\u003Cp>Title of widget can be customized in widget settings\u003C\u002Fp>\n\u003C\u002Fli>\n\u003Cli>\n\u003Cp>Compatible with blocks under widgets section\u003C\u002Fp>\n\u003C\u002Fli>\n\u003C\u002Fol>\n\u003Ch4>My Links\u003C\u002Fh4>\n\u003Cul>\n\u003Cli>\u003Ca href=\"https:\u002F\u002Fwww.muraliwebworld.com\u002Fgroups\u002Fwordpress-plugins-by-muralidharan-indiacitys-com-technologies\u002Fforum\u002Ftopic\u002Fcategory-sub-category-widget-for-wordpress-websites-using-php-javascript-jquer\u002F\" rel=\"nofollow ugc\">Plugin homepage\u003C\u002Fa>\u003C\u002Fli>\n\u003Cli>\u003Ca href=\"https:\u002F\u002Fwordpress.org\u002Fplugins\u002Fpush-notification-for-post-and-buddypress\u002F\" rel=\"ugc\">Push notification plugin for WordPress,BuddyPress and for Mobile apps\u003C\u002Fa>\u003C\u002Fli>\n\u003Cli>Twitter @\u003Ca href=\"https:\u002F\u002Ftwitter.com\u002Findiacitys\" rel=\"nofollow ugc\">indiacitys\u003C\u002Fa>\u003C\u002Fli>\n\u003Cli>Facebook \u003Ca href=\"https:\u002F\u002Fwww.facebook.com\u002Findiacitys\" rel=\"nofollow ugc\">indiacitys\u003C\u002Fa>\u003C\u002Fli>\n\u003C\u002Ful>\n","This widget allows to add\u002Fupdate icons for category or icon for custom taxonomy. It lists Categories in horizontal menu pattern.",700,38011,94,3,"2025-12-01T21:05:00.000Z","6.9.4","6.2","8.0",[20,21,22,23,24],"category","category-list","subcategory","subcategory-list","widget","https:\u002F\u002Fwww.muraliwebworld.com\u002Fgroups\u002Fwordpress-plugins-by-muralidharan-indiacitys-com-technologies\u002Fforum\u002Ftopic\u002Fcategory-sub-category-widget-for-wordpress-websites-using-php-javascript-jquer\u002F","https:\u002F\u002Fdownloads.wordpress.org\u002Fplugin\u002Fcategory-subcategory-list-widget.7.3.zip",100,0,null,"2026-03-15T15:16:48.613Z",[],{"slug":33,"display_name":7,"profile_url":8,"plugin_count":34,"total_installs":35,"avg_security_score":36,"avg_patch_time_days":37,"trust_score":38,"computed_at":39},"murali-indiacitys",2,900,98,72,87,"2026-04-04T18:14:49.198Z",[41,62,82,100,119],{"slug":42,"name":43,"version":44,"author":45,"author_profile":46,"description":47,"short_description":48,"active_installs":49,"downloaded":50,"rating":28,"num_ratings":28,"last_updated":51,"tested_up_to":52,"requires_at_least":53,"requires_php":54,"tags":55,"homepage":59,"download_link":60,"security_score":61,"vuln_count":28,"unpatched_count":28,"last_vuln_date":29,"fetched_at":30},"most-popular-categories","Most Popular Categories","1.1.1","blueinstyle","https:\u002F\u002Fprofiles.wordpress.org\u002Fblueinstyle\u002F","\u003Cp>This is just a small WordPress plugin that lists the most popular categories by post count in a widget. Includes several options.\u003C\u002Fp>\n\u003Cp>Useful for blogs with many categories and just want to list the most popular.\u003C\u002Fp>\n\u003Cp>For Themes that do not support Widgets, you can now put this code anywhere in your template:\n     \u003C\u002Fp>\n\u003Cp>Support and Feature requests are on my forums at http:\u002F\u002Fjustmyecho.com\u002Fforums\u002F\u003C\u002Fp>\n","Display your most popular categories in a widget",600,5524,"2011-04-07T07:23:00.000Z","3.1.4","2.8","",[56,21,57,58,24],"categories","popular-categories","top-categories","http:\u002F\u002Fjustmyecho.com\u002F2010\u002F11\u002Fmost-popular-categories-widget-for-wordpress\u002F","https:\u002F\u002Fdownloads.wordpress.org\u002Fplugin\u002Fmost-popular-categories.1.1.1.zip",85,{"slug":63,"name":64,"version":65,"author":66,"author_profile":67,"description":68,"short_description":69,"active_installs":70,"downloaded":71,"rating":72,"num_ratings":73,"last_updated":74,"tested_up_to":16,"requires_at_least":75,"requires_php":76,"tags":77,"homepage":80,"download_link":81,"security_score":27,"vuln_count":28,"unpatched_count":28,"last_vuln_date":29,"fetched_at":30},"multiple-category-selection-widget","Multiple Category Selection Widget","4.0.0","zackdesign","https:\u002F\u002Fprofiles.wordpress.org\u002Fzackdesign\u002F","\u003Cp>Turn your WordPress post categories into a search powerhouse! This plugin gives you a set of dropdown menus based on parent categories and their sub-categories. Users select one sub-category per parent, and the plugin filters posts matching the selected combination.\u003C\u002Fp>\n\u003Cp>\u003Cstrong>Available as:\u003C\u002Fstrong>\u003C\u002Fp>\n\u003Cul>\n\u003Cli>\u003Cstrong>Gutenberg Block\u003C\u002Fstrong> — “Multi-Category Filter” in the block inserter (new in v4)\u003C\u002Fli>\n\u003Cli>\u003Cstrong>Classic Widget\u003C\u002Fstrong> — “Multi-Category Selection” in Appearance > Widgets\u003C\u002Fli>\n\u003Cli>\u003Cstrong>Shortcode\u003C\u002Fstrong> — \u003Ccode>[mcsw]\u003C\u002Fcode> on any page or post\u003C\u002Fli>\n\u003C\u002Ful>\n\u003Cp>\u003Cstrong>Features:\u003C\u002Fstrong>\u003C\u002Fp>\n\u003Cul>\n\u003Cli>AND \u002F OR category filtering — find posts matching ALL or ANY selected categories\u003C\u002Fli>\n\u003Cli>AJAX chained drilldown — selecting a parent dynamically loads its children\u003C\u002Fli>\n\u003Cli>Pretty permalink URLs (\u003Ccode>\u002Fcategories\u002F3,5\u002Fsearch_type\u002Fand\u002Forder\u002Ftitle\u002F\u003C\u002Fcode>)\u003C\u002Fli>\n\u003Cli>Ordering by title or default\u003C\u002Fli>\n\u003Cli>Configurable blank search behavior\u003C\u002Fli>\n\u003Cli>Exclude specific categories\u003C\u002Fli>\n\u003Cli>Lightweight — no jQuery, no external dependencies\u003C\u002Fli>\n\u003Cli>Pagination support\u003C\u002Fli>\n\u003Cli>Display form above results on category pages (optional)\u003C\u002Fli>\n\u003C\u002Ful>\n\u003Cp>\u003Cstrong>Sample use case:\u003C\u002Fstrong>\u003C\u002Fp>\n\u003Cp>Real estate — set up parent categories like “Bedrooms”, “Bathrooms”, “Price Range” with sub-categories beneath them. Users filter listings by selecting from each dropdown.\u003C\u002Fp>\n\u003Cp>\u003Cstrong>Upgrading from v3.x:\u003C\u002Fstrong>\u003C\u002Fp>\n\u003Cul>\n\u003Cli>PHP sessions have been removed entirely — the URL now carries all state, which means better compatibility with caching plugins, load balancers, and modern hosting\u003C\u002Fli>\n\u003Cli>jQuery has been replaced with vanilla JavaScript\u003C\u002Fli>\n\u003Cli>CSS classes have changed from \u003Ccode>wpmcsw\u003C\u002Fcode>\u002F\u003Ccode>wpmm\u003C\u002Fcode> to BEM-style \u003Ccode>mcsw-*\u003C\u002Fcode> classes — update any custom CSS\u003C\u002Fli>\n\u003Cli>The old \u003Ccode>select-chain.js\u003C\u002Fcode> in the plugin root has been replaced by \u003Ccode>js\u002Fselect-chain.js\u003C\u002Fcode>\u003C\u002Fli>\n\u003C\u002Ful>\n","Filter posts by selecting multiple categories using dropdown menus. Available as a widget, block, or shortcode.",200,77654,58,14,"2026-02-23T10:01:00.000Z","6.0","7.4",[20,78,79,22,24],"filter","post","https:\u002F\u002Fzackdesign.biz","https:\u002F\u002Fdownloads.wordpress.org\u002Fplugin\u002Fmultiple-category-selection-widget.4.0.0.zip",{"slug":83,"name":84,"version":85,"author":86,"author_profile":87,"description":88,"short_description":89,"active_installs":90,"downloaded":91,"rating":92,"num_ratings":93,"last_updated":94,"tested_up_to":95,"requires_at_least":96,"requires_php":54,"tags":97,"homepage":54,"download_link":99,"security_score":61,"vuln_count":28,"unpatched_count":28,"last_vuln_date":29,"fetched_at":30},"subcategory-list-widget","Flynsarmy Subcategory List Widget","1.2.2","flynsarmy","https:\u002F\u002Fprofiles.wordpress.org\u002Fflynsarmy\u002F","\u003Cp>Adds a widget that can displays subcategories of a given category (or top level). Has options to show\u002Fhide post counts, exclude categories, depth limits and\u002For empty subcategories.\u003C\u002Fp>\n","Adds a widget that can displays subcategories of a given category (or top level).",70,4444,76,4,"2021-04-27T02:26:00.000Z","5.7.15","3.5.2",[20,98,22,24],"list","https:\u002F\u002Fdownloads.wordpress.org\u002Fplugin\u002Fsubcategory-list-widget.zip",{"slug":101,"name":102,"version":103,"author":104,"author_profile":105,"description":106,"short_description":107,"active_installs":108,"downloaded":109,"rating":27,"num_ratings":34,"last_updated":110,"tested_up_to":111,"requires_at_least":112,"requires_php":54,"tags":113,"homepage":117,"download_link":118,"security_score":61,"vuln_count":28,"unpatched_count":28,"last_vuln_date":29,"fetched_at":30},"gna-cate-list","GNA Cate List","0.9.8","Chris Mok","https:\u002F\u002Fprofiles.wordpress.org\u002Fchris_dev\u002F","\u003Cp>[catelist] shortcodes with any post, page and even text widget.\u003C\u002Fp>\n\u003Ch4>NEED HELP?\u003C\u002Fh4>\n\u003Cp>\u003Cstrong>\u003Ca href=\"http:\u002F\u002Fwebgna.com\u002F\" rel=\"nofollow ugc\">FAQs\u003C\u002Fa>\u003C\u002Fstrong> | \u003Cstrong>\u003Ca href=\"http:\u002F\u002Fwebgna.com\u002F\" rel=\"nofollow ugc\">Tech Support\u003C\u002Fa>\u003C\u002Fstrong>\u003C\u002Fp>\n\u003Ch3>Languages Available\u003C\u002Fh3>\n\u003Cul>\n\u003Cli>English\u003C\u002Fli>\n\u003C\u002Ful>\n","[catelist] shortcodes with any post, page and widget.",10,1985,"2016-09-05T04:07:00.000Z","4.7.32","3.9",[114,21,115,116,24],"cate-list","catelist","shortcode","http:\u002F\u002Fwordpress.org\u002Fplugins\u002Fgna-cate-list\u002F","https:\u002F\u002Fdownloads.wordpress.org\u002Fplugin\u002Fgna-cate-list.0.9.8.zip",{"slug":120,"name":121,"version":122,"author":123,"author_profile":124,"description":54,"short_description":125,"active_installs":108,"downloaded":126,"rating":28,"num_ratings":28,"last_updated":127,"tested_up_to":95,"requires_at_least":128,"requires_php":129,"tags":130,"homepage":135,"download_link":136,"security_score":61,"vuln_count":28,"unpatched_count":28,"last_vuln_date":29,"fetched_at":30},"ovn-category-list-widget-for-elementor","OVN Category List Widget for Elementor","1.0.0","OutsourcingVN","https:\u002F\u002Fprofiles.wordpress.org\u002Foutsourcingvn\u002F","Show Category List or Custom Taxonomy List",849,"2021-07-15T05:05:00.000Z","5.2","7.2",[131,132,133,134],"category-list-widget","category-list-widget-for-elementor","elementor","outsourcing","https:\u002F\u002Foutsourcingvn.com\u002F","https:\u002F\u002Fdownloads.wordpress.org\u002Fplugin\u002Fovn-category-list-widget-for-elementor.zip",{"attackSurface":138,"codeSignals":161,"taintFlows":174,"riskAssessment":175,"analyzedAt":181},{"hooks":139,"ajaxHandlers":150,"restRoutes":157,"shortcodes":158,"cronEvents":159,"entryPointCount":160,"unprotectedCount":28},[140,146],{"type":141,"name":142,"callback":143,"file":144,"line":145},"action","widgets_init","category_subcategory_list_widget_init","category-list-widget.php",367,{"type":141,"name":147,"callback":148,"file":144,"line":149},"admin_init","category_subcategory_list_widget_admin_init",547,[151],{"action":152,"nopriv":153,"callback":154,"hasNonce":155,"hasCapCheck":153,"file":144,"line":156},"iclcat_new_icon",false,"category_subcategory_list_widget_ajax_new_icon",true,608,[],[],[],1,{"dangerousFunctions":162,"sqlUsage":163,"outputEscaping":165,"fileOperations":28,"externalRequests":28,"nonceChecks":34,"capabilityChecks":28,"bundledLibraries":173},[],{"prepared":28,"raw":28,"locations":164},[],{"escaped":166,"rawEcho":34,"locations":167},52,[168,171],{"file":144,"line":169,"context":170},615,"raw output",{"file":144,"line":172,"context":170},651,[],[],{"summary":176,"deductions":177},"The \"category-subcategory-list-widget\" plugin v7.3 demonstrates a generally strong security posture based on the provided static analysis. The absence of dangerous functions, file operations, external HTTP requests, and raw SQL queries are all positive indicators.  The high percentage of properly escaped output and the presence of nonce checks further contribute to a secure foundation.\n\nHowever, a significant concern is the complete lack of capability checks. While nonce checks are present, relying solely on them for AJAX handlers can leave the plugin vulnerable to privilege escalation if an attacker can trick a privileged user into triggering the AJAX action. The limited attack surface with only one unprotected AJAX handler is a positive, but the absence of capability checks on it is a notable oversight.\n\nWith zero recorded vulnerabilities and no history of CVEs, the plugin has a good track record. This suggests a commitment to security by the developers, or simply a lack of discovery in past versions.  Overall, the plugin is well-coded with good sanitization practices, but the absence of capability checks on its entry point represents a distinct weakness that warrants attention.",[178],{"reason":179,"points":180},"Missing capability checks on AJAX handler",8,"2026-03-16T19:22:40.047Z",{"wat":183,"direct":188},{"assetPaths":184,"generatorPatterns":185,"scriptPaths":186,"versionParams":187},[],[],[],[],{"cssClasses":189,"htmlComments":192,"htmlAttributes":193,"restEndpoints":195,"jsGlobals":196,"shortcodeOutput":197},[190,191],"wn_status","widget-core_special_widgets_categories-2-wn_show",[],[194],"data-widget_id",[],[],[]]